How SNAP’s work requirements is hurting one West Virginia woman

The One Big Beautiful Bill Act imposed stricter work requirements on SNAP, leading to 14,000 West Virginians losing food assistance. Helen Comer, a 62-year-old recipient, had her benefits reduced to $24 a month due to the new rules, which require 80 hours of work, training, or volunteering monthly for those under 65.
